Afghan women defiant after lynching and burning in Kabul

Crescent International

Jumada' al-Akhirah 02, 14362015-03-22

Women are greatly oppressed in Afghanistan's tribal society but the lynching and burning of a 27-year-old woman in Kabul has horrified people worldwide. In Kabul, women took the unprecedented step of carrying the coffin of the victim, Farkhunda, to the cemetery amid calls for the arrest and punishment of the culprits and the police that stood by watching the mob perpetrate the crime.

Former Yemeni president chased to his Aden hideout

Crescent International

Jumada' al-Ula' 28, 14362015-03-19

You can run but you can't hide seems to be the message being delivered by one ousted president Ali Abdullah Saleh to another, Abd Rabbu Mansour Hadi. The Saudis forced Saleh to resign in February 2012; the Houthis drove Hadi from power last month and put him under house arrest in Sana'a. Hadi fled to Aden making it his temporary capital but trouble seems to have followed him there as today's attack on Aden Airport showed.

Death sentence for Brotherhood chief, 13 others

Crescent International

Jumada' al-Ula' 26, 14362015-03-17

An Egyptian court has handed down another batch of mass death sentences. The victims include leader of the Ikhwan al Muslimoon Mohamed Badie and 13 others. An additional 31 persons in prison will be sentenced on April 11.
